Exposure is an inclusive community of women, trans, and non-binary individuals. We recognize and value the contributions that our non-traditional community makes to skateboarding and it is our intention to provide safe and inclusive spaces for competition and coming together.
IF YOU CHOOSE TO COMPETE IN OUR EVENT, YOU WILL BE COMPETING WITH OUR WHOLE COMMUNITY.
Exposure Skate does not and shall not discriminate on the basis of race, color, religion (creed), gender, gender expression, age, national origin (ancestry), disability, marital status, sexual orientation, or military status, in any of its activities, events, or operations. These activities include, but are not limited to, hiring and firing of staff, selection of volunteers and vendors, provision of services, participation at our events or inclusion on our social media channels. We are committed to providing an inclusive and welcoming environment for all members of our staff, clients, volunteers, subcontractors, vendors, and participants.

Schedule
- Friday
- 8am - 6pm: Bowl and Street Open for Practice
- 12pm - 4pm: Registration Open
- 1pm - 6pm: Vert Ramp Construction
- 4pm: Riders Meeting
- Saturday
- 8:30am: Registration
- 9am: Street Intermediate
- 50 skaters, 1 minute breaks between
- 3 skater Jams, 3 minutes each
- Score based on overall impression
- Top 6 advance to Finals
- Finals immediately following
- Final Jams: 2 skaters, 3 minutes
- 11am – 5pm: Vert Practice
- 11am: Bowl Advanced
- 25 skaters, 2 minute breaks between
- Organized Jams of 5
- 3 runs, 40 seconds each
- Skate until you fall
- Best run is scored
- Top 5 advance to Finals
- Finals immediately following, same format
- 1pm: Bowl Intermediate
- 3pm: Bowl Golden (30 & Up)
- Same format as above, without a separate Finals
- 4pm: Bowl Open/Pro
- Same format as above, but no timed runs
- Top 8 advance to finals
- $1,000 Longest Frontside Grind, $1,000 Longest Backside Grind, open to everyone
- Awards immediately following
- 6:30pm: Hard stop time
- Sunday
- 8:30am: Registration
- 9am: Street Advanced
- 50 skaters, 1 minute breaks between
- 3 skater Jams, 3 minutes each
- Score based on overall impression
- Top 6 advance to Finals
- Finals immediately following
- Final Jams: 2 skaters, 3 minutes
- 11am: Vert Intermediate
- 20 skaters, 2 minute breaks between
- Organized Jams of 5
- 4 runs, 30 seconds each
- Skate until you fall
- Best run is scored
- Immediately following: Domestic violence survivors speech
- 12:30pm: Vert Open/Pro
- 20 skaters, 2 minute breaks between
- Organized Jams of 6
- 4 runs, 30 seconds each
- Skate until you fall
- Best run is scored
- Top 6 advance to Finals
- Final immediately following
- Same format, but no timed runs
- 1:30pm: Vert Best Trick, open to everyone
- $1,500 cash for tricks, plus winner receives $1,500
- 2pm: $1,000 Vert Highest Air Backside, $1,000 Vert Highest Air Frontside, $1,000 Longest Slide, open to everyone
- 3pm: Street Open/Pro
- 36 skaters, 1 minute breaks between
- 2 skater Jams, 3 minutes each
- Score based on overall impression
- Top 8 advance to Finals
- Final Jams: 2 skaters, 4 minutes
- Street Best Trick immediately following, open to everyone (obstacle TBD)
- $1,500 cash for tricks, plus winner receives $1,500
- Awards immediately following
- 6:30pm: Hard stop time
